The aim of this book is to briefly present
modern optical measurement techniques to measure the thermal and flow parameters in-flight. Furthermore, advanced optical methods to measure the deformation of the surface of wings and rotor blades of aircraft will be presented. Readers will gain knowledge as a result of research conducted in the framework
of the two European projects AIM and AIM² and verified during the flight test on various types of aircraft. These have included the Evektor VUT100, Airbus A380, Dornier 228, Fairchild Metro II, Janus, PW-6, Piaggio P180 and Scottish Aviation Bulldog.

Boden, Fritz
- born in Dresden in 1979, finished his study in Mechanical Engineering (specialization on Aircraft-Engineering) at the Technical University in Dresden in 2005. Since 2005 he works at the Institute of Aerodymanics and Flow Technologies of the German Aerospace Center (DLR). First he started in the Department of Technical Acoustics in Braunschweig.Since End of 2006 he works in the Department of Experimental Methods in Göttingen and focuses on optical in-flight measurement techniques. Fritz Boden coordinated the projects AIM and AIM². He joined several flight test campaigns e.g. on Piaggio P 180, Airbus A320, Airbus A380 and Eurocopter EC-135.
